Macromedia announced Wednesday that it is offering a free update to its Web Publishing System application suite. The new version includes Macromedia Contribute 3.1 and Macromedia Contribute Publishing Services 1.1. Quark Inc. has announced the imminent release of QPS 3.5, the latest iteration of its Quark Publishing System publishing workflow software. Previewing the new release at NEXPO 05, the Newspaper Association of Americas annual conference and exhibition, Quark is boasting new features, increased functionalities and expanded integration capabilities for this new version. Linspire Inc. announced Wednesday that it has released the latest version of its desktop Linux operating system, Linspire “Five-0.” The San Diego-based company, which was known as Lindows until reaching a settlement last year with Microsoft Corp. over trademark issues, has incorporated nearly 1,200 improvements and enhancements into the new version. Adobe Systems Inc. and Japanese mobile telephone provider NTT DoCoMo Inc. announced Wednesday that NTT DoCoMo will use Adobe Reader LE for its 3G FOMA mobile phones.
